About N-[2-[3-(2-fluorophenyl)-5-(3-methoxyphenyl)-3,4-dihydropyrazol-2-yl]-2-oxoethyl]-N-(2-methoxyethyl)-2-methylpropanamide

N-[2-[3-(2-fluorophenyl)-5-(3-methoxyphenyl)-3,4-dihydropyrazol-2-yl]-2-oxoethyl]-N-(2-methoxyethyl)-2-methylpropanamide (PubChem CID 51068023) has the molecular formula C25H30FN3O4 and a molecular weight of 455.53 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is N-[2-[3-(2-fluorophenyl)-5-(3-methoxyphenyl)-3,4-dihydropyrazol-2-yl]-2-oxoethyl]-N-(2-methoxyethyl)-2-methylpropanamide.
